Output 34286ec28685fbd19d753ea8074bab1ae0a95c091b92c298aa1a3430e3d1056c:0

value
19896560
script pubkey
OP_0 OP_PUSHBYTES_20 1b044caa0ddcb869e256cfc6983d99576b317652
address
ltc1qrvzye2sdmjuxncjkelrfs0ve2a4nzajjq59pgs
transaction
34286ec28685fbd19d753ea8074bab1ae0a95c091b92c298aa1a3430e3d1056c
spent
true